David
R Cole works as a senior lecturer at the University of Technology,
Sydney,
where he lectures in literacy and pedagogy.
David uses his knowledge in multiple and
affective literacies to investigate areas of social interest. He is
currently researching young Muslims in Australia, and recently arrived
immigrant families in New South Wales.
He has published more than twenty peer-reviewed
articles in international journals such as Educational Philosophy
and Theory, Prospect and Education and Power. He has also produced
three edited books in 2009, called, Multiple Literacies Theory: A
Deleuzian Perspective (Sense Publishers) with Diana Masny, Multiliteracies
and Technology Enhanced Education: Social Practice and the Global
Classroom (IGI Publishers) with Darren Pullen, and Multiliteracies
in Motion: Current Theory and Practice (Routledge) with Darren Pullen.
He published a novel in 2006 called A Mushroom of Glass.
